Hurtigruten Group was founded in 1893 and is a world leader in adventure travel. We have over 2400 employees worldwide from more than 50 countries. Our operations take place in three main areas – Hurtigruten Expeditions, Hurtigruten Norway and Hurtigruten Svalbard – offering unique, small ship- and land-based adventures from pole to pole. We take guests to the most spectacular places on our planet, visiting everything from pristine wilderness to diverse communities. Hurtigruten Group is revolutionizing the tourism industry's approach to sustainability, offering authentic local experiences that leave a footprint we are proud of – both in nature and in the communities we visit. Hurtigruten Norway's have seven ships connecting 34 communities along our rugged coastline, bringing you closer to nature and local communities on what is called the World's Most Beautiful Sea Voyage. In addition, we have MS Trollfjord which sales to Svalbard in the summer and North-cape in the winter and from January 2024 we even have MS Otto Sverdrup which sales from Hamburg to Norwegian destinations. We have been offering a unique combination for local travellers, freight and international tourists since our first departure almost 130 years ago.
